//! # Parameters
//!
//! Allows to update configuration parameters at runtime.
//!
//! ## Pezpallet API
//!
//! This pezpallet exposes two APIs; one *inbound* side to update parameters, and one *outbound*
//! side to access said parameters. Parameters themselves are defined in the runtime config and will
//! be aggregated into an enum. Each parameter is addressed by a `key` and can have a default value.
//! This is not done by the pezpallet but through the
//! [`pezframe_support::dynamic_params::dynamic_params`] macro or alternatives.
//!
//! Note that this is incurring one storage read per access. This should not be a problem in most
//! cases but must be considered in weight-restrained code.
//!
//! ### Inbound
//!
//! The inbound side solely consists of the [`Pezpallet::set_parameter`] extrinsic to update the
//! value of a parameter. Each parameter can have their own admin origin as given by the
//! [`Config::AdminOrigin`].
//!
//! ### Outbound
//!
//! The outbound side is runtime facing for the most part. More general, it provides a `Get`
//! implementation and can be used in every spot where that is accepted. Two macros are in place:
//! [`pezframe_support::dynamic_params::define_parameters` and
//! [`pezframe_support::dynamic_params:dynamic_pallet_params`] to define and expose parameters in a
//! typed manner.
//!
//! See the [`pezpallet`] module for more information about the interfaces this pezpallet exposes,
//! including its configuration trait, dispatchables, storage items, events and errors.
//!
//! ## Overview
//!
//! This pezpallet is a good fit for updating parameters without a runtime upgrade. It is very handy
//! to not require a runtime upgrade for a simple parameter change since runtime upgrades require a
//! lot of diligence and always bear risks. It seems overkill to update the whole runtime for a
//! simple parameter change. This pezpallet allows for fine-grained control over who can update
//! what. The only down-side is that it trades off performance with convenience and should therefore
//! only be used in places where that is proven to be uncritical. Values that are rarely accessed
//! but change often would be a perfect fit.

//! ## Low Level / Implementation Details
//!
//! The pezpallet stores the parameters in a storage map and implements the matching `Get<Value>`
//! for each `Key` type. The `Get` then accesses the `Parameters` map to retrieve the value. An
//! event is emitted every time that a value was updated. It is even emitted when the value is
//! changed to the same.
//!
//! The key and value types themselves are defined by macros and aggregated into a runtime wide
//! enum. This enum is then injected into the pezpallet. This allows it to be used without any
//! changes to the pezpallet that the parameter will be utilized by.
//!
//! ### Design Goals
//!
//! 1. Easy to update without runtime upgrade.
//! 2. Exposes metadata and docs for user convenience.
//! 3. Can be permissioned on a per-key base.
//!
//! ### Design
//!
//! 1. Everything is done at runtime without the need for `const` values. `Get` allows for this -
//! which is coincidentally an upside and a downside. 2. The types are defined through macros, which
//! allows to expose metadata and docs. 3. Access control is done through the `EnsureOriginWithArg`
//! trait, that allows to pass data along to the origin check. It gets passed in the key. The
//! implementor can then match on the key and the origin to decide whether the origin is
//! permissioned to set the value.
use pezframe_support::pezpallet_prelude::*;
use pezframe_system::pezpallet_prelude::*;
use pezframe_support::traits::{
dynamic_params::{AggregatedKeyValue, IntoKey, Key, RuntimeParameterStore, TryIntoKey},
EnsureOriginWithArg,
};
mod benchmarking;
#[cfg(test)]
mod tests;
mod weights;
pub use pezpallet::*;
pub use weights::WeightInfo;
/// The key type of a parameter.
type KeyOf<T> = <<T as Config>::RuntimeParameters as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key;
/// The value type of a parameter.
type ValueOf<T> = <<T as Config>::RuntimeParameters as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value;
#[pezframe_support::pezpallet]
pub mod pezpallet {
use super::*;
#[pezpallet::config(with_default)]
pub trait Config: pezframe_system::Config {
/// The overarching event type.
#[pezpallet::no_default_bounds]
#[allow(deprecated)]
type RuntimeEvent: From<Event<Self>>
+ IsType<<Self as pezframe_system::Config>::RuntimeEvent>;
/// The overarching KV type of the parameters.
///
/// Usually created by [`pezframe_support::dynamic_params`] or equivalent.
#[pezpallet::no_default_bounds]
type RuntimeParameters: AggregatedKeyValue;
/// The origin which may update a parameter.
///
/// The key of the parameter is passed in as second argument to allow for fine grained
/// control.
#[pezpallet::no_default_bounds]
type AdminOrigin: EnsureOriginWithArg<Self::RuntimeOrigin, KeyOf<Self>>;
/// Weight information for extrinsics in this module.
type WeightInfo: WeightInfo;
}
#[pezpallet::event]
#[pezpallet::generate_deposit(pub(crate) fn deposit_event)]
pub enum Event<T: Config> {
/// A Parameter was set.
///
/// Is also emitted when the value was not changed.
Updated {
/// The key that was updated.
key: <T::RuntimeParameters as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key,
/// The old value before this call.
old_value: Option<<T::RuntimeParameters as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value>,
/// The new value after this call.
new_value: Option<<T::RuntimeParameters as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value>,
},
}
/// Stored parameters.
#[pezpallet::storage]
pub type Parameters<T: Config> =
StorageMap<_, Blake2_128Concat, KeyOf<T>, ValueOf<T>, OptionQuery>;
#[pezpallet::pezpallet]
pub struct Pezpallet<T>(_);
#[pezpallet::call]
impl<T: Config> Pezpallet<T> {
/// Set the value of a parameter.
///
/// The dispatch origin of this call must be `AdminOrigin` for the given `key`. Values be
/// deleted by setting them to `None`.
#[pezpallet::call_index(0)]
#[pezpallet::weight(T::WeightInfo::set_parameter())]
pub fn set_parameter(
origin: OriginFor<T>,
key_value: T::RuntimeParameters,
) -> DispatchResult {
let (key, new) = key_value.into_parts();
T::AdminOrigin::ensure_origin(origin, &key)?;
let mut old = None;
Parameters::<T>::mutate(&key, |v| {
old = v.clone();
*v = new.clone();
});
Self::deposit_event(Event::Updated { key, old_value: old, new_value: new });
Ok(())
}
}
/// Default implementations of [`DefaultConfig`], which can be used to implement [`Config`].
pub mod config_preludes {
use super::*;
use pezframe_support::derive_impl;
/// A configuration for testing.
pub struct TestDefaultConfig;
#[derive_impl(pezframe_system::config_preludes::TestDefaultConfig, no_aggregated_types)]
impl pezframe_system::DefaultConfig for TestDefaultConfig {}
#[pezframe_support::register_default_impl(TestDefaultConfig)]
impl DefaultConfig for TestDefaultConfig {
#[inject_runtime_type]
type RuntimeEvent = ();
#[inject_runtime_type]
type RuntimeParameters = ();
type AdminOrigin = pezframe_support::traits::AsEnsureOriginWithArg<
pezframe_system::EnsureRoot<Self::AccountId>,
>;
type WeightInfo = ();
}
}
}
impl<T: Config> RuntimeParameterStore for Pezpallet<T> {
type AggregatedKeyValue = T::RuntimeParameters;
fn get<KV, K>(key: K) -> Option<K::Value>
where
KV: AggregatedKeyValue,
K: Key + Into<<K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key>,
<K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key: IntoKey<
<<Self as RuntimeParameterStore>::AggregatedKeyValue as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key,
>,
<<Self as RuntimeParameterStore>::AggregatedKeyValue as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value:
TryIntoKey<<K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value>,
<K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value: TryInto<K::WrappedValue>,
{
let key: <K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Key = key.into();
let val = Parameters::<T>::get(key.into_key());
val.and_then(|v| {
let val: <KV as AggregatedKeyValue>::Value = v.try_into_key().ok()?;
let val: K::WrappedValue = val.try_into().ok()?;
let val = val.into();
Some(val)
})
}
}
